More and more North Texans are expanding their families — fur families, to be exact. As dog ownership continues to surge across the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ex, our beloved canine companions have become a central part of our lives and, increasingly, our home designs.
From high-rise luxury condos in Uptown to sprawling single-family estates in Preston Hollow and Lakewood, the Dallas real estate market has heavily embraced dog-friendly features. Between our blistering July heat waves and our sudden winter freezes, having the right setup at home makes life safer, easier, and much more comfortable for both dogs and their humans.
Here is a look at the most sought-after home amenities for Dallas dog lovers.
In vibrant, walkable Dallas neighborhoods like the Arts District, Victory Park, or Deep Ellum where private green space can be limited, on-site dog runs are a massive luxury. Elite multi-family developments and modern townhomes are increasingly incorporating fenced-in, private dog parks equipped with high-end artificial turf, drainage systems, and agility equipment. For single-family homes, dedicated side-yard dog runs featuring K9 Grass (which stays cooler in the Texas sun) allow your pup plenty of safe, off-leash playtime right at home.
Anyone who has taken their dog for a rainy-day walk along the Katy Trail or a muddy afternoon at White Rock Lake knows the aftermath. Dragging a muddy pup through a pristine home to a primary bathtub is a headache. Enter the dedicated dog shower. Typically built into high-functioning mudrooms or laundry suites, these elevated, tiled wash stations save your back and keep the mess contained. Outfitted with detachable handheld shower heads, non-slip textured tiles, and integrated commercial-grade blow dryers, they make post-trail cleanup seamless.
Upscale high-rises and master-planned communities across DFW are taking pet care a step further by offering fully equipped, self-service pet spas. Rather than fighting for an appointment at a crowded boutique groomer in Park Cities, residents can access professional-grade grooming tables, specialized washing basins, and premium drying stations within their own building. It provides all the convenience of a professional spa day without the stress of travel or the mess inside your personal living space.
Hectic corporate schedules, long commutes on the Tollway, and active social calendars can make it tough to keep up with an active dog’s routine. To answer this, premier high-rises and luxury developments are partnering with top-tier Dallas pet care companies to offer on-site, on-demand dog walking, pet sitting, and training. Having a trusted, vetted professional available right at the concierge desk gives busy urban dwellers total peace of mind during long days at the office or weekend trips.
For the design-conscious homeowner, traditional floor bowls just won’t do—especially in a custom Dallas kitchen. High-end builds are now incorporating seamless, built-in feeding stations into kitchen islands, lower cabinetry, or mudroom built-ins. These setups feature pull-out drawers that conceal food and water bowls when guests arrive. The ultimate luxury detail? An integrated pot filler installed directly above the water bowl for effortless refills, paired with beautiful, custom-carved stone or quartz surrounds that match the home's overall aesthetic.
Dallasites love a good patio scene, and our dogs do too. To foster a sense of community, luxury multi-unit buildings and neighborhood associations are frequently hosting private pet-centric events. From exclusive residents-only "Yappy Hours" on rooftop terraces to seasonal pet costume contests, these gatherings are the perfect way for newcomers to mingle, network, and let their four-legged friends socialize in a safe, controlled environment.
Optimizing a home for a pet is no longer just a niche trend; it’s a major selling point in the competitive North Texas market. Homes that seamlessly integrate these pet-centric luxuries don't just cater to our furry best friends—they elevate the daily living experience and long-term property value for the homeowner.
